Salome HOME
fix ADAO catalogs path
authorPaul RASCLE <paul.rascle@edf.fr>
Tue, 26 Mar 2019 10:57:22 +0000 (11:57 +0100)
committerJean-Philippe ARGAUD <jean-philippe.argaud@edf.fr>
Wed, 27 Mar 2019 09:34:36 +0000 (10:34 +0100)
resources/CMakeLists.txt
src/daSalome/daGUI/daGuiImpl/adaoCase.py
src/daSalome/daYacsSchemaCreator/methods.py

index b5845b2fec3c2979db32ef7ff39aa2179fac44ae..7961ad3c4eb8bf9ec2dd876b670bf0835cd3a3fd 100644 (file)
@@ -19,7 +19,7 @@
 # Author: Anthony Geay, anthony.geay@edf.fr, EDF R&D
 
 if(ADAO_SALOME_MODULE)
-  install(FILES SalomeApp.xml DESTINATION ${ADAO_RES})
+  install(FILES SalomeApp.xml ADAOCatalog.xml DESTINATION ${ADAO_RES})
 else(ADAO_SALOME_MODULE)
-  install(FILES ADAOCatalog.xml ADAOSchemaCatalog.xml DESTINATION ${ADAO_RES})
+  install(FILES ADAOSchemaCatalog.xml DESTINATION ${ADAO_RES})
 endif(ADAO_SALOME_MODULE)
index f49e95cfe62afa2d135cf34b089c70a8a90c410c..82afbff48209abfe3ea0e4908165220db911aff5 100644 (file)
@@ -83,10 +83,10 @@ class AdaoCase:
       msg += "case with the ADAO/EFICAS editor."
       return msg
 
-    if "ADAO_ROOT_DIR" not in os.environ:
-      return "Please add ADAO_ROOT_DIR to your environnement."
+    if "ADAO_ENGINE_ROOT_DIR" not in os.environ:
+      return "Please add ADAO_ENGINE_ROOT_DIR to your environnement."
 
-    adao_path = os.environ["ADAO_ROOT_DIR"]
+    adao_path = os.environ["ADAO_ENGINE_ROOT_DIR"]
     adao_exe = adao_path + "/bin/salome/AdaoYacsSchemaCreator.py"
     args = ["python", adao_exe, filename, self.yacs_filename]
     p = subprocess.Popen(args)
index 7b275e35815590923fff457c36baf6df2c9cd875..09e79f6f56f4514fc2fba9bfa13a7a04616c0dae 100644 (file)
@@ -56,7 +56,7 @@ def create_yacs_proc(study_config):
   l.registerProcCataLoader()
   runtime = pilot.getRuntime()
   try:
-    catalogAd = runtime.loadCatalog("proc", os.environ["ADAO_ROOT_DIR"] + "/share/salome/resources/adao/ADAOSchemaCatalog.xml")
+    catalogAd = runtime.loadCatalog("proc", os.environ["ADAO_ENGINE_ROOT_DIR"] + "/share/salome/resources/adao/ADAOSchemaCatalog.xml")
     runtime.addCatalog(catalogAd)
   except:
     raise ValueError("Exception in loading ADAO YACS Schema catalog")